This groundbreaking book, written by Jonathan Gray, delves deep into the fascinating realm of parody and its impact on television programs and genres.
With a skillful blend of textual theory, discussions of television, and ideas of parody and comedy, Gray offers a comprehensive analysis of how The Simpsons has become a master of critical commentary. Through extensive primary audience research, this book uncovers the ingenious ways in which The Simpsons challenges the norms of three key television genres - the sitcom, adverts, and the news.
But this book goes beyond just dissecting the show's parodies. Gray explores the power of The Simpsons to reshape the meanings, power, and effects of these genres. By provoking reinterpretations and offering media-literate recontextualizations, The Simpsons holds the potential to transform our understanding of popular entertainment and even tackle political and social issues.
